Web15 jan. 2024 · However, while nearly everyone in Hawaii has a repertoire of at least 25 Hawaiian words, only about 24,000 people actually speak the language. That number is smaller than the number of people in Hawaii speaking Tagalog, with 45,163 speakers, Japanese with 38,561 speakers, and Ilocano (another Filipino language) with 36,275. …
Web8 apr. 2024 · But with 25,000 speakers, Spanish is the fourth most dominant language in the state, a ranking that pales when compared to the mainland where Spanish is the top language other than English.
